Nvidia is reportedly in talks to present a $250 billion financing package deal for a giant OpenAI data center project in Ohio — days after CEO Jensen Huang voiced assist for controversial “open source” AI fashions used more and more by China.

Nvidia’s ensures would help the ChatGPT maker lease a 10-gigawatt project — the most important the industry has yet seen, costing as a lot as $500 billion in whole — that Japanese billionaire Masayoshi Son’s SoftBank is developing in southern Ohio through its vitality subsidiary, according to a Wall Street Journal report on Sunday.

The AI pioneer has been in superior talks to lease the positioning for a number of weeks, per the Journal report and Anthropic, Microsoft and Google have also spoken to Commerce Secretary Howard Lutnick about the project.

The potential deal has also reignited fears that Nvidia is singlehandedly propping up the AI growth. Financiers including Goldman Sachs merchants and famed investor Michael Burry of “Big Short” have for months sounded the alarm that such agreements are “circular” in nature, where Nvidia funds and takes stakes in firms and initiatives that use its chips.

Meanwhile, Huang — in his first post ever on X late Friday — issued a letter rallying for controversial open-source fashions that was also signed by other tech titans including Microsoft, Meta, IBM and Palantir Technologies. The group – calling itself the Open Secure AI Alliance – called on lawmakers to keep away from “premature restrictions on open models that stifle competition ⁠or drive innovation overseas.”

The missive by Huang was widely seen in tech circles as a landmark second in the intensifying debate over open vs closed-source AI fashions that has roiled Silicon Valley and Washington.    

On one facet, Huang and other tech titans say fashions that aren’t solely managed by one company pace the development of AI and stop energy from being overly concentrated. Opponents — most notably Anthropic and OpenAI — say releasing AI blueprints fingers unhealthy actors the keys to construct AI instruments that can be utilized for nefarious functions.

Anthropic CEO Dario Amodei said in a 2023 testimony before the US Senate Judiciary Committee that open source AI was transferring down a “very dangerous path” — a warning he has recently stepped up.

Altman, meanwhile, has also argued against open source AI – but last 12 months OpenAI launched some instruments with open source parts, recognized as open weights.

“It was clear that if we didn’t do it, the world was gonna be mostly built on Chinese open-source models,” Altman told CNBC last 12 months.

Huang acknowledged in his letter that open-source AI fashions carry a risk but that in the long-run they’ll AI to create “innovation and prosperity.”

“To be sure, open weights carry real and distinct risks. Once released, the weights are beyond the original developer’s control, and modified versions are difficult to trace or reverse,” Huang wrote in the alliance’s letter. “But the right response to this risk is not to prohibit open weights.”

The alliance group said Monday it’s developing and is aiming to deploy open-source AI instruments that any company can use to thwart cyberattacks.

The Ohio project is a big wager for both Lutnick and the Trump administration. As half of Japan’s tariff settlement with the U.S., Tokyo dedicated $33 billion to construct a natural-gas energy facility on federal land that can be operated by SB Energy, a company managed by SoftBank’s Son.

Lutnick, Son and Energy Secretary Chris Wright broke ground on the positioning – Built on a former uranium-enrichment web site south of Columbus – in March. The U.S. can pay SB Energy to run the plant, while Japan and America will cut up energy income until Japan recovers its investment. After that, the U.S. would obtain 90% of the proceeds.

Other tech giants are exploring this model – Google, for occasion, has backstopped some data facilities for Anthropic.

Nvidia and other supporters of open-source have argued that proprietary instruments from firms like Anthropic or OpenAI can equally be misused and have their safeguards circumvented. But disseminating the AI capabilities widely with open-source instruments will permit everybody to find a way to defend themselves.

Nvidia’s backing of the data center project would permit the SoftBank-owned developer to raise debt at more favorable phrases than it may if OpenAI had no financial backer since the Sam Altman-led startup is an unprofitable non-public company and thus has no investment-grade credit ranking.

Nvidia already has $30 billion driving on OpenAI and is also discussing a deal to finance chip shopping for for OpenAI, which may whole $350 billion, according to the Journal.

The proposed mega AI campus would eat roughly 10 gigawatts of electrical energy – enough to energy a number of million houses – and take years to full with the first section anticipated to be completed in 2028.
